Travelling from La Ceiba Airport (LCE) to Tegucigalpa Airport (TGU): what you need to know
Hop on a direct flight from La Ceiba Airport to Tegucigalpa Airport and you'll be in the air for an average of 40 minutes.
Choose from 12 weekly La Ceiba Airport to Tegucigalpa Airport flights. The 07:30 departure with Aerolineas Sosa is the earliest you can take. Aerolineas Sosa operates the latest service of the day at 14:00.
Your LCE to TGU flight won't wait if you're running late, so show up at the airport on time. Arrive up to one hour in advance for domestic flights and two hours ahead for international travel.

Handy information about La Ceiba Airport (LCE)
Of all flights departing from La Ceiba Airport, 50% land on time at their destination.
Central La Ceiba to La Ceiba Airport is approximately 6 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take you about 10 minutes to get there if you're ride-sharing, catching a taxi or driving.
Planning to catch public transport? Expect a trip time of around 20 minutes.

When to fly to Tegucigalpa Airport (TGU)
It's time to pick your travel dates for your flight from La Ceiba Airport to Tegucigalpa Airport. April is the most popular month to head to Tegucigalpa. If you like a quieter vibe, go in March.
When booking your flight from La Ceiba Airport to Tegucigalpa Airport, think about the kind of weather you enjoy. April is the warmest month in Tegucigalpa, with temperatures ranging from 17ºC (63ºF) to 32ºC (90ºF).
Search for cheap tickets from LCE to TGU in January if you like c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 14ºC (57ºF) and 27ºC (81ºF) on average.
